python调用typecho的xmlrpc 上传文件 返回数据出错


xmlrpc调用接口返回数据错误如下:
xml.parsers.expat.ExpatError: junk after document element: line 2, column 0
有文档说是两个顶级element,但是这个确是只有一个methodResponse,求甚解
接口输出如下:

<?xml version="1.0"?>
<methodResponse>
  <params>
    <param>
      <value>
        <struct>
  <member><name>file</name><value><string>remote.jpg</string></value></member>
  <member><name>url</name><value><string>http://test.com/upload/125719595.jpg</string></value></member>
</struct>
      </value>
    </param>
  </params>
</methodResponse>

xml python typecho xmlrpc

Zhaku 10 years, 9 months ago

Your Answer